Price Analysis: What Impacts Your 6kW Hybrid Investment in Sweden?
Let's address the elephant in the room: the Growatt inverter 6kW hybrid price in Sweden typically ranges from 9,500-12,500 SEK (€850-€1,100), but this is just one piece of the puzzle. Why such variation? Consider these factors:
Total System Cost Drivers
- Battery pairing: Adding 5kWh storage increases investment by 15,000-20,000 SEK
- Installation complexity: Steep Malmö rooftops vs. ground mounts
- Swedish subsidies: The Solcellsstöd program covers 20% of installation costs
Industry data from SolarPower Europe shows Swedish payback periods averaging 6-8 years—considerably faster than Germany's 10+ years.

Why Growatt Outperforms in Nordic Conditions
You might wonder—why choose Growatt over European brands? The answer lies in Arctic-ready engineering. While testing by DNV revealed competitors struggle below -15°C, Growatt's dynamic startup technology maintains functionality at -30°C. The hybrid topology also solves Sweden's unique challenge: balancing summer overproduction (20 sunlight hours) with winter scarcity (4 hours).
Technical Edge in Swedish Context
- Patented anti-condensation heating prevents frost damage
- Nordic-mode battery optimization extends lifespan by 3 years
- Integrated grid support meets Energimyndigheten VDE-AR-N 4105 standards
